This Certificate Programme in Optimizing a STEAM Curriculum equips educators with the skills to design and implement engaging, effective STEAM (Science, Technology, Engineering, Arts, and Mathematics) learning experiences. Participants will gain practical strategies to integrate technology, foster creativity, and promote collaborative learning within a STEAM context.
The programme's learning outcomes include mastering curriculum design principles for STEAM education, developing proficiency in utilizing technology for enhanced learning, and implementing assessment strategies that align with STEAM goals. Graduates will be equipped to create innovative and relevant projects that cater to diverse learners and cultivate 21st-century skills.
The duration of the Certificate Programme in Optimizing a STEAM Curriculum is typically flexible, ranging from 6 to 12 weeks depending on the chosen learning pathway and intensity. This allows for both part-time and full-time participation, accommodating busy schedules.

Why this course?
Certificate programmes in optimising a STEAM curriculum are increasingly significant in the UK's evolving job market. The demand for skilled professionals in science, technology, engineering, arts, and mathematics (STEAM) is booming. According to a recent report by the UK government, STEM roles are projected to increase by 13% by 2030. This growth necessitates continuous professional development, making STEAM curriculum optimisation certificate programmes highly valuable for educators and industry professionals alike.
These programmes equip participants with the latest pedagogical approaches and technological tools, allowing them to effectively integrate emerging technologies like AI and machine learning into teaching practices. The ability to adapt and innovate within a STEAM context is crucial. For example, a study by the UK's Office for National Statistics reveals that only 36% of STEM graduates are employed in STEM roles within 5 years of graduating. This highlights a need to bridge the gap between education and industry through enhanced curriculum design and delivery, something these certificate programmes directly address.
